aap-gateway Helm Chart

Helm Lint Helm Publish

A community Helm chart for deploying Ansible Automation Platform on Red Hat OpenShift. Compatible with AAP 2.5 and 2.6+.

The chart renders a single AnsibleAutomationPlatform CR. The AAP Operator reconciles it and manages all child resources (AutomationController, EDA, Hub, database, Redis). You bring the values — the operator does the rest.

Prerequisites

  • Red Hat OpenShift 4.x
  • AAP Operator installed in the target namespace
  • Helm 3.x

Installation

From Quay (recommended)

The chart is published to quay.io/achanoia/aap-gateway on every version bump.

# Install a specific version
helm install aap-gateway oci://quay.io/achanoia/aap-gateway \
  --version 1.1.0 \
  -f my-values.yaml \
  --set namespace=aap \
  -n aap --create-namespace

# Upgrade
helm upgrade aap-gateway oci://quay.io/achanoia/aap-gateway \
  --version 1.1.0 \
  -f my-values.yaml \
  --set namespace=aap \
  -n aap

Note: --set namespace=aap sets the chart value .Values.namespace, which the chart requires to render the CR. The -n aap flag is the Helm release namespace and is independent — omitting namespace from your values will cause the install to fail with namespace is required and must not be empty. Set it in your values file to avoid passing --set every time:

namespace: aap

Components

The chart supports four components. All are enabled by default, matching the AAP Gateway operator behavior. Set disabled: true to skip a component.

Component Key Default
Gateway API always on
AutomationController controller.disabled false (enabled)
Event-Driven Ansible eda.disabled false (enabled)
Automation Hub hub.disabled false (enabled)
controller:
  disabled: false

eda:
  disabled: false

hub:
  disabled: false
  file_storage_storage_class: my-storage-class

Component pass-through

Any field from the component's own CRD spec can be set directly under the component key:

controller:
  web_resource_requirements:
    requests:
      cpu: "500m"
      memory: "1Gi"
    limits:
      cpu: "2"
      memory: "2Gi"
  task_resource_requirements:
    requests:
      cpu: "250m"
      memory: "512Mi"
  task_privileged: true

hub:
  web:
    resource_requirements:
      requests:
        cpu: "250m"
        memory: "512Mi"

Refer to the CRD definitions in crds/ for all available fields per AAP version (reference only — CRDs are installed by the AAP Operator, not this chart).

Note — string-typed complex fields: Some fields in the child CRDs (AutomationController, EDA, AutomationHub) look like objects or arrays but are declared as type: string (JSON-encoded). Passing these as native YAML will cause the child CR admission webhook to reject them. Before setting any structured-looking field on a component, check its type in crds/<version>/. If it says type: string, pass it as a pre-serialized JSON string via extraSpec:

extraSpec:
  controller:
    node_selector: '{"node-role.kubernetes.io/worker":""}'
    service_annotations: '{"app.kubernetes.io/managed-by":"helm"}'
  hub:
    node_selector: '{"node-role.kubernetes.io/worker":""}'

Database

Internal (default)

The operator deploys and manages a PostgreSQL pod automatically. Tune it with:

database:
  postgres_storage_class: my-storage-class
  postgres_keep_pvc_after_upgrade: true
  resource_requirements:
    requests:
      cpu: "500m"
      memory: "1Gi"
  storage_requirements:
    requests:
      storage: "20Gi"

External

Point to a pre-existing PostgreSQL instance:

database:
  database_secret: my-postgres-secret

The Secret must contain: host, port, database, username, password.

Redis

By default the operator deploys a standalone Redis pod. Override with an external instance:

redis:
  redis_secret: my-redis-secret

For cluster mode:

redis_mode: cluster
redis:
  replicas: 3

Networking

The chart defaults to an OpenShift Route with Edge TLS termination. The hostname drives both the Route and the Gateway's public URL.

hostname: aap.apps.cluster.example.com
route_tls_termination_mechanism: Edge  # Edge | Passthrough
route_tls_secret: my-tls-secret        # optional — operator generates a cert if omitted

For standard Kubernetes Ingress:

ingress_type: ingress
ingress_class_name: nginx
ingress_path: /
ingress_path_type: Prefix
ingress_tls_secret: my-tls-secret

For LoadBalancer:

service_type: LoadBalancer
loadbalancer_port: 443
loadbalancer_protocol: https  # http | https

Secrets

Value Description
admin_password_secret Existing Secret with password key — operator sets admin password from it
bundle_cacert_secret Secret with a custom CA bundle for TLS verification
db_fields_encryption_secret Secret for database field-level encryption key

Contributing

After cloning, install the local git hooks:

bash hack/setup-hooks.sh

This installs a pre-commit hook that runs helm-docs (keeps README in sync with values.yaml) and helm lint --strict before every commit. Requires helm and helm-docs (brew install helm-docs).

Versioning

Chart versioning is independent of the AAP operator version. A single chart works across AAP 2.5 and 2.6+.

Chart version AAP compatibility
1.0.x AAP 2.5, 2.6

The chart is published automatically to Quay whenever Chart.yaml is updated on main.
